Cord Moving & Storage
United Van Lines agent serving the St Louis and Kansas City corridors. Long history and steady performance in the Midwest.
Best for: Midwest interstate
Watch out: Smaller agent network outside the Midwest.

North American (part of SIRVA) leans toward complex and high-value relocations, with strong piano and antique handling. For a basic studio across town, a local independent will almost always undercut their price.
Best for: Cross-country moves with high-value items
Watch out: Local move pricing is rarely competitive against regional independents.
